The only thing I can really tell you is to do your research because you can't even trust the sites that claim to feature the top 100 hundred work from home programs.
As a guide however your should:
Do your research by checking forums.
Try to avoid programs that ask for payment.
Avoid programs where their sites are unprofessional and tacky.
Avoid programs that claim that you only have to work a couple of hours a day, because I can guarantee you that it will take long hours to achieve anything worthwhile.
Check Ripoffreport.com to see if others have been scammed in the program you are interested in.
Avoid program that offers unrealistic monthly income.
